Released in late 2017, Getting Over It with Bennett Foddy is a psychological endurance test disguised as a climbing simulator. Version 2.579 represents one of many updates to a title that has become a cult classic for its intentionally difficult physics and philosophical commentary. The Core Experience: Why We Suffer
The game’s premise is deceptively simple: you play as a man named Diogenes, trapped in a metal pot, who must climb a mountain of surreal junk using only a Yosemite hammer.
Physics-Based Punishment: Every movement is tied to the mouse. There are no save points; a single slip can send you back to the very beginning, a mechanic designed to evoke "new types of frustration".
The Narrator’s Voice: As you struggle, Bennett Foddy provides a dry, philosophical monologue. He quotes thinkers and reflects on the nature of failure, often precisely when you have just lost significant progress.
The End Goal: For those with enough patience—typically between 2 hours and infinity—a "magical reward" awaits at the peak. Technical Specifications and Performance

Gameplay Mechanics and Philosophy
The core of the game is its intentionally difficult and often frustrating controls. Control Scheme
: You move the hammer exclusively with your mouse. The motion is precise and demands extreme patience; a single slip can result in losing hours of progress, as the game has no checkpoints. The "B-Game" Homage : The game is a tribute to the 2002 title Sexy Hiking
by Jazzuo. It embraces the "unfriendly" and janky nature of early indie games. Philosophical Narrative
: Throughout the climb, Bennett Foddy provides a voiceover with philosophical observations about failure and perseverance, designed to comfort or taunt the player depending on their current level of frustration. System Requirements
